              • Originally posted by coolboy007 View Post
                Bro, why should it break on a impact when a rider at 40kph falls on a road, crumple zones in cars work because they save the passengers, crumple zones shouldnt work even when you hit a rickshaw at 30 kph.

                The helmet broke off and in turn it hurt my sister's face which was badly bruised. I mean, till a particular limit the lid should stay intact, what if the head hits a divider after the lid breaks off.
                Incidentally crumple zones are supposed to work around the same speed as you mentioned. The testing of the zones happens in three stages. The minimum speed at which they must crumple is 30 kmph. In most accidents the speed at which the car is travelling (on braking) is approximately the same. (BTW this is Off topic...I will try doing a small article on this later)
                The breaking of the helmet can be attributed to various reasons. Was the helmet abused earlier (like dropped a couple of times, banged against when parked etc).
                Most of us do not really take care of the helmet as we should. One common thing I have seen is people lock the helmet on the helmet lock in such a way that it protrudes outwards, where it can get easily banged upon by other bikes etc. Best is to lock the helmet and place it on the seat (if lock is on the grabrail) or if it is on the crash guard then move it as close to the bike as possible.
                In the end, a lot depends upon what we call Luck....however, dont tempt fate, be careful.
